在现代信息社会,网络安全和加密通信越来越受到用户的重视。为了实现这些目标,很多人会选择代理工具,其中 SS(Shadowsocks)和 VMess 是目前较为流行的两种协议。在本文中,我们将重点分析 SS 和 VMess 之间的区别,包括它们的协议特点、适用场景以及优缺点等。
什么是SS?
Shadowsocks(简称 SS)是一种高性能的安全代理,可以将网络流量进行加密后再转发给目标服务器。它采用了多种不同的加密方法来保护用户的网络流量。其优势在于:
- 地址隐蔽性强
- 传输速度快
- 配置简单
SS的工作原理
SS 的工作原理相对简单,当用户向某一地址发送请求时,SS 客户端会加密请求内容并通过代理服务器进行转发,最后返回的响应内容亦恒会经过加密处理,确保数据的安全性。多年以来,SS 吸引了大批用户,但随着技术的发展,其缺陷也逐渐显露。
什么是VMess?
VMess 是 V2Ray 项目的一个通信协议,和 Shadowsocks 类似,但其设计思想更为全面,目标在于提升代理工具的可配置性与灵活性。基本特点包括:
- 支持多种传输协议
- 具备抗干扰能力
- 能实现多重路由
VMess的工作原理
VMess 的条段设计使得其可以承载更加复杂的业务。当用户请求到达时,VMess 会依据其内部的路由器设置选择最优路径传输数据,并且在每次连接前都有认证步骤,确保数据的完整性和真实性。
SS与VMess的主要区别
| 特点 | SS | VMess | |————-|—————————–|—————————| | 协议类型| 自定义协议 | 开放协议 | | 灵活性 | 相对简单,不支持复杂设置 | 设置灵活,多路由支持 | | 安全性 | 安全性一般 | 安全性更高 | | 实时性能| 适合快速度低延迟的场景 | 更佳的性能与抗干扰能力 |
SS与VMess各自的优缺点分析
SS的优点
- 安装与配置方便
- 较高的传输速度
- 良好的隐蔽性
SS的缺点
- 安全性相对较低
- 无法应对复杂网络情况
VMess的优点
- 灵活多样的路由设计
- 更高的安全性与时效性
- 支持自定义配置与多个协议
VMess的缺点
- 配置与安装比 SS 复杂
- 对原始数据进行加密解密计算,因此性能损耗可能更高
适用场景
在考虑使用 SS 或 VMess 时,要根据实际需求选择适合的工具。
- 如果你是普通用户,只需要简单的翻墙或隐匿身份,使用 SS 会更为适宜。
- 如果对数据的安全性及隐私要求高,或者需要在复杂网络环境中下使用,VMess 则更合适。
FAQ(常见问答)
Q1: SS和VMess哪个更安全?
A: VMess 相较于 SS 更注重安全性,具有多重授权和验证,这一点在处理敏感信息时尤其重要。
Q2: 如何选择使用SS还是VMess?
A: 要根据具体用例来进行选择,如果仅为普通的速度和隐蔽 betyr Tack,则选择 SS;如果兼顾隐私及多样性的线路选择,考虑了解 VMess。
Q3: 把SS与VMess结合使用会怎样?
A: 理论上可以在实现上实现兼容,但是可能会出现复杂的配置需求,影响实际效果,难以达到本来的路由目的。
Q4: 如何进行部署与配置?
A: 两者均有丰富的在线文档与社区支持,对于一般用户可根据自身使用环境参考相关部署教程进行适量的设置。
总结
虽然最初 SS 用途较广泛,但是 VMess 无疑展现了更强的平台适配性。在选择合适的代理工具时,使用者需要充分调研自己的具体使用需求,从多维度进行对比,以便有效利用网络技术,确保自身数据安全和隐私保护。